The Modern Challenge: Why Oral Health Matters
Oral health is often overlooked, yet it plays a critical role in overall wellness. The mouth is home to millions of bacteria—some beneficial, some harmful. When the balance shifts, problems like bad breath, plaque buildup, gum inflammation, and tooth decay can develop.
For many people, maintaining oral health is a daily struggle. Despite regular brushing and flossing, issues persist. Bleeding gums, persistent bad breath, and plaque buildup are common complaints that affect confidence, social interactions, and overall health.
Common Oral Health Challenges:
- Persistent bad breath (halitosis)
- Bleeding gums during brushing or flossing
- Plaque and tartar buildup
- Gum inflammation and sensitivity
- Tooth decay and cavities
- Dry mouth
Traditional approaches to oral health focus on mechanical cleaning—brushing, flossing, and mouthwash. While these are essential, they don’t always address the underlying factors that contribute to oral health issues. Factors like diet, stress, hormonal changes, and the oral microbiome all play important roles.

The Importance of the Oral Microbiome
The oral microbiome is a complex community of bacteria, fungi, and other microorganisms. When this ecosystem is balanced, it supports healthy teeth, gums, and fresh breath. When disrupted, problems can arise.
Factors That Disrupt the Oral Microbiome:
| Factor | Impact |
|---|---|
| Antibacterial mouthwash | Kills good and bad bacteria indiscriminately |
| Poor diet | High sugar intake feeds harmful bacteria |
| Stress | Weakens immune response |
| Smoking or tobacco | Alters the oral environment |
| Medications | Some drugs reduce saliva production |
| Aging | Natural changes in saliva production and immune function |
